Drove up to the ferry terminal and right onto the ferry to get home. I was dropped off at Nicole's and we headed out for the longest run we've done so far. Here is a map of the route we took:



It was so long! The weather was beautiful though and I felt fine until we were leaving Stanley Park. I started getting really tired and sore - mostly my feet. It was such a relief to reach Science World and start heading for home. We walked the last mile to cool down. The map shows 22.5 miles but I think I may have cut some corners when creating it because I'm pretty sure it was closer to 24. We basically ran a marathon which is only 2.2 miles farther. Yikes! I took 5 gels, about 40min apart. We were so hungry by the end... that's what happens when you run from 4-9pm and miss dinner. Thankfully our wonderful husbands had made pizza and when we walked in the front door it had just come out of the oven and smelled so good!!

All in all it was a very long day and I collapsed into bed after a hot bath with a Marathon bubble bar from Lush. Mmm, cinnamon and mint. Very soothing for tired muscles. I feel ok today, tired but not too bad. My legs are very tired but I don't think the stiffness has quite set in yet. I can still walk down stairs and my knees feel fine - they didn't hurt at all during the run. Next week is a short run (12-14 miles) and then we've got one more long one (22-26 miles). Two weeks of very short runs (10 miles, then 7 miles) and then it's the race!
